The Digital Net

The Iranian Ports and Maritime Organization recently announced the implementation of a new local tracking and reporting system for all vessels entering their territorial waters. On the surface, the announcement sounds like typical bureaucratic record-keeping. The official line mentions "safety," "environmental protection," and "enhanced coordination."

But look closer.

Under the new mandate, ships are required to report their positions, cargo details, and destinations directly to Iranian authorities through a localized framework that mirrors—but operates independently of—the traditional international Automatic Identification System (AIS). By creating a parallel digital infrastructure, Tehran is effectively building a "smart border" in the sea.

Consider the logistical reality for a ship’s officer. Usually, navigating international waters relies on a shared, global understanding of transparency. You broadcast your position so everyone stays safe. Now, there is a second knock at the door. To pass through the Strait, you must now acknowledge a specific, local digital authority. It is the maritime equivalent of a country suddenly deciding that every car on an international highway must install a specific, state-monitored GPS tracker just to use a five-mile stretch of road.

Why Data is the New Deterrent

Control in the 21st century doesn't always look like a blockade. It looks like a database.

By mandating this new system, Iran gains a granular, real-time map of every moving piece in the Strait. They aren't just seeing blips on a radar; they are collecting a massive library of economic intelligence. They know which companies are moving what volume of goods, where those goods are headed, and exactly how long the transit takes.

This isn't about safety. It’s about leverage.

In a world defined by sanctions and "maximum pressure" campaigns, information is the only currency that doesn't lose value. If you know exactly which tanker is carrying oil for a specific rival, and you have a legal, system-based reason to query that ship's data or flag a "discrepancy" in its reporting, you have the power to slow down the gears of global commerce without ever firing a shot.

The Strait of Hormuz has always been a theater of physical tension. We’ve seen the headlines of seized tankers and drone strikes. But this digital pivot is more subtle and, in many ways, more effective. It creates a "new normal" where Iranian oversight is baked into the very software of maritime transit.

The Ghost in the Machine

Shipping companies now face a grueling dilemma. On one hand, the maritime industry thrives on predictability. Anything that streamlines traffic in a crowded waterway should be a good thing. On the other hand, there is the persistent shadow of "cyber-sovereignty."

When a state creates its own proprietary tracking system, it creates a "walled garden." This allows for a level of selective enforcement that international systems are designed to prevent. If a ship’s local transponder "fails" or if the data doesn't match the state's internal records, the legal pretext for an inspection or a delay becomes much easier to justify.

The stakes for the average consumer are invisible but immense. You don't feel the tension in the Strait when you fill up your gas tank or buy a new smartphone, but the cost of "uncertainty" is always added to the bill. Insurance premiums for tankers are calculated based on risk. When a regional power asserts a new level of digital control over a primary trade route, the risk profile changes. The "war risk" surcharges creep up. The cost of shipping rises.

Eventually, that cost lands on your doorstep.
